Title
Senior Accountant - Finance & Reporting
Reports To
Accounting Manager – Finance & Reporting
Job Overview
The Senior Accountant will be accountable for the full cycle accounting functions for our Retail Operations and Store Support Centres with the objective of delivering a high level of accuracy, integrity and timeliness. They will be a key liaison with various functions in the business including Operations, Construction and Design and Merchandising. Additionally, the Senior Accountant will ensure completeness, accuracy, and timeliness of financial information in supporting our weekly and monthly accounting close process.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Lead retail operations accounting, monthly close and financial reporting process, including management analysis
- Support operations accounting team in the preparation of the monthly analysis
- Completion of Balance Sheet reconciliations
- Preparation and analysis of Store and Department level period reporting
- Assist AP with invoice coding review activities for assigned departments and business lines.
- Preparation of working papers for the monthly internal reporting packages, including analytical commentary.
- Assist in the preparation of working papers for the quarterly and annual financial audit.
- Ensure internal controls compliance in assigned accounting and financial reporting activities.
- Participate in special projects in the Finance area and provide ad hoc financial analysis, as required.
- Preparation of input tax remittances and liaison with applicable tax authorities
- Support Accounting and Integration of acquisitions and other transactions
- Such other duties and functions as the Company may assign from time to time.
Competencies and Requirements
- Experience in the preparation and presentation of monthly, quarterly, and annual reporting packages
- Excellent organization skills and written and verbal communication skills
- Comfortable representing the accounting team with expertise and authority in areas accounting
- Handles department and store cost centre level accounting and reporting.
- Strong problem solving and decision-making abilities
- Experience working with large volumes of data
- Ability to work in fast paced ever changing environment with a proven track record of successfully juggling conflicting priorities
- MS excel proficient - experience with pivots, VLOOKUP’s and excel formulae. Experience with SQL and other analytical tools also an asset.
Education, Training and Experience
- University Degree with professional accounting designation
- Minimum of 3-5 years progressive finance/accounting - with at least 1 year of full cycle accounting experience
- Advanced knowledge of internal controls and finance/business best practices
- Experience in a multi-unit retail or consumer goods distribution environment is preferred
- Advanced level knowledge of Microsoft desktop applications (Excel, PowerPoint, Access)
- Experience with Microsoft D365, Greenline and/or COVA is preferred
- Group and Multi Banner experience will be an added advantage
